Things to do in Sacramento?Sacramento, California is a vibrant city full of adventures and activities for all. Enjoy the mix of urban amenities and natural surroundings in the area with a trip to Old Sacramento or the American River Parkway. Explore some of the most unique attractions in the region at Sutter's Fort State Historic Park or relax along the shores of Lake Natoma. With plenty of outdoor recreation, culture, cuisine, and more, Sacramento provides something for everyone!
Things to do in Charlottesville?Charlottesville, Virginia lies between Richmond & Washington D.C., making it an ideal spot for those who want access to urban life without actually living in a big city environment. Home to Thomas Jefferson’s Monticello estate, Charlottesville boasts gorgeous architecture plus numerous wineries & eateries where you can sample some amazing local cuisine. Outdoor recreation opportunities abound here too: take your pick from hikes through beautiful mountain trails or canoeing down Big Run Creek - both will leave you with lasting memories!
